网页设计越来越注重用户体验和视觉效果。CSS圆角矩形作为一种重要的视觉元素,广泛应用于网页设计、UI界面设计、移动端应用等领域。本文将围绕CSS圆角矩形的设计艺术与实践,探讨其在现代网页设计中的应用与发展。
一、CSS圆角矩形的设计原理
1. 圆角矩形的定义
圆角矩形是指矩形四个角都为圆弧形状的图形。在CSS中,我们可以通过设置元素的`border-radius`属性来创建圆角矩形。
2. 圆角矩形的视觉特点
圆角矩形相较于传统矩形,更具亲和力和视觉吸引力。以下是圆角矩形的一些视觉特点:
(1)柔和的过渡:圆角矩形使得矩形边缘的过渡更加柔和,减少了视觉上的突兀感。
(2)空间感:圆角矩形相较于矩形,更具有空间感,有助于提升整体视觉效果。
(3)易于识别:圆角矩形易于识别,有利于提高用户的操作效率和体验。
二、CSS圆角矩形的设计技巧
1. 选择合适的圆角半径
圆角半径是决定圆角矩形形状的关键因素。以下是一些选择圆角半径的技巧:
(1)根据实际需求:根据元素的实际需求选择合适的圆角半径,如按钮、卡片等。
(2)遵循视觉规律:遵循视觉规律,使圆角矩形更具视觉美感。
(3)保持一致性:在设计过程中,保持圆角半径的一致性,提升整体视觉效果。
2. 利用伪元素创建圆角矩形
伪元素可以用于创建圆角矩形,以下是一些常见的方法:
(1)使用`::before`和`::after`伪元素:通过设置伪元素的`content`属性为空,利用`border-radius`和`width`/`height`属性创建圆角矩形。
(2)利用`div`标签:通过设置`div`标签的`border-radius`属性,配合其他属性创建圆角矩形。
3. 圆角矩形的布局
圆角矩形的布局方法如下:
(1)浮动布局:通过设置元素的`float`属性,实现圆角矩形在页面中的水平布局。
(2)Flex布局:利用Flex布局,实现圆角矩形在页面中的垂直和水平布局。
(3)Grid布局:使用Grid布局,实现圆角矩形在页面中的复杂布局。
三、CSS圆角矩形的应用案例
1. 按钮设计
圆角矩形在按钮设计中具有重要作用,以下是一个简单的按钮设计案例:
```css
.button {
background-color: 4CAF50;
color: white;
border: none;
padding: 15px 32px;
text-align: center;
text-decoration: none;
display: inline-block;
font-size: 16px;
margin: 4px 2px;
cursor: pointer;
border-radius: 20px;
}
```
2. 卡片设计
圆角矩形在卡片设计中可以提升视觉效果,以下是一个简单的卡片设计案例:
```css
.card {
background-color: f2f2f2;
border: 1px solid ccc;
border-radius: 10px;
box-shadow: 0 2px 4px rgba(0,0,0,0.1);
padding: 20px;
margin: 20px;
width: 300px;
}
```
CSS圆角矩形在现代网页设计中具有重要作用,通过巧妙地运用圆角矩形,可以提升网页的整体视觉效果和用户体验。本文从圆角矩形的设计原理、设计技巧、应用案例等方面进行了探讨,希望能为设计师提供一定的参考和借鉴。在今后的网页设计中,圆角矩形将继续发挥其独特魅力,为互联网世界带来更多美好体验。